Genelia Deshmukh Looks Regal In A Chikankari Saree At Sitaare Zameen Par Premiere

Last Updated: Genelia Deshmukh draped a quintessential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la chikankari saree at the premiere of Sitaare Zameen Par. Genelia Deshmukh, who stars alongside actor-producer Aamir Khan in the latest movie Sitaare Zameen Par, made a royal statement in a quintessential chikankari saree at the movie's premiere in Mumbai. The ethereal chikankari which is done in Lucknow by female artisans was envisioned by master couturiers Abu Jani and Sandeep Khosla. The saree which takes anywhere between six and eight months to complete, is deeply rooted in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la 's design journey which is over 35 years. An epitome of grace and refinement, the saree was complemented with an embellished blouse featuring glistening sequins, pearls strategically embroidered in miniature floral patterns. The blouse was completed with pearl tassels placed on the hem of the sleeves. Genelia and Aamir Khan both were dressed in the hallmark chikankari beautifully celebrated by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la. Genelia was accompanied by her husband and actor Riteish Deshmukh. A starry affair, the premiere of Sitaare Zameen Par was also attended by celebrities such as Shah Rukh Khan, Salman Khan, Vicky Kaushal, Rekha, Tamannaah Bhatia, Jackie Shroff, Tiger Shroff, Juhi Chawla, Darsheel Safary, Imran Khan and Junaid Khan, among others, attended the screening. Aamir Khan Finally Ditched The T-Shirt For A Bandhgala At Sitaare Zameen Par Premiere

Last Updated: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la wanted Aamir Khan to ditch the jeans and T-shirt look and try formal kurtas, sherwanis and bandhgalas. Actor and producer Aamir Khan graced the premiere of his movie, Sitaare Zameen Par looking suave in a chikankari ensemble designed by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la. Aamir Khan who loves sporting basic tees on various occasions, wowed everyone with his desi look at the premiere. To everyone's surprise Aamir made an entrance in an intricately embroidered chikankari bandhgala paired with an ivory kurta and churidar pants. In a candid chat with Aamir Khan, the designer duo teased the superstar on his excessively casual approach to clothing, and we are glad Aamir chose to listen to them. A rare combination of cinema and couture was creatively celebrated by Aamir Khan and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la. Chikankari demands time, patience, skill and devotion just like Aamir's heartwarming films that are rich in craft and storytelling. When asked how the experience working with Aamir was, Abu Sandeep expressed that it was 'Pure Joy'. 'Meeting Aamir after many years and spending time together was truly delightful. We adore him as an artist – his creativity and craft are unparalleled. He is one of our finest. We deeply appreciate his attention to offbeat subjects; it's so refreshing to see films that aren't run-of-the-mill, but instead, are full of heart and soul," add Abu Sandeep. advetisement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la's journey with the art of Chikankari has been celebrated by an array of powerful women including Deepika Padukone, Sonam Kapoor, Kareena Kapoor Khan, Nita Mukesh Ambani, Natasha Poonawalla, Isha Ambani, among others. Aamir Khan was seen sharing a hug with his co-star Genelia Deshmukh at the premiere, who looked like a vision in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la's chikankari saree. Genelia was accompanied by her husband, actor Riteish Desmukh. Sitaare Zameen Par, which is all set to release on June 20, saw the who's who of Bollywood attend the premiere. Aamir Khan was spotted sharing a fun camaraderie with Salman Khan and Shah Rukh Khan. The celebrities who also made their presence felt at the screening were Vicky Kaushal, Tamannaah Bhatia, Rekha, Jackie Shroff, Tiger Shroff, Imran Khan, Junaid Khan, Juhi Chawla, Himesh Reshammiya, Ashutosh Gowariker, Tusshar Kapoor, Jitendra, Vidhu Vinod Chopra, Rajkumar Hirani, Nitanshi Goel, Ali Fazal, Rhea Chakraborty and Farah Khan. Aamir Khan's 'Sitaare Zameen Par' premiere will be a couture spectacle

Aamir Khan's 'Sitaare Zameen Par' premiere is set to be a high-fashion event, with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la designing the wardrobe. Behind-the-scenes photos reveal intricate ajrakh prints and meticulous styling for the cast, including Genelia Deshmukh and ten newcomers. The premiere promises a blend of cinema and couture, creating a sartorial celebration ahead of the film's June 20, 2025 release. The countdown to Sitaare Zameen Par has officially begun and while the sports comedy-drama is promising to tug at the heartstrings, its red-carpet premiere is shaping up to be a masterclass in high fashion. With legendary couturiers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la at the helm of the wardrobe department, expect the Sitaare premiere to shine with star-studded glamour and precision tailoring. Taking to Instagram, Aamir Khan Productions dropped a series of behind-the-scenes photos, giving fans a sneak peek into what the cast will be wearing on the big night. 'Premiere looks are about to get legendary,' the caption read, teasing a 'Sitaare-studded surprise' that's set to rival any fashion week runway. In the BTS snippets, one standout moment shows Aamir Khan admiring a sharply tailored jacket featuring intricate ajrakh print, a nod to traditional Indian craftsmanship with a contemporary twist. It's clear that the looks aren't just about style; they're layered with meaning, history, and detail - true to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la's design DNA. Joining Khan in the style parade is Genelia Deshmukh, along with ten fresh faces making their debut. Each newcomer has been styled with the same meticulous attention to detail, creating a collective fashion narrative that blends luxury with youthful energy. Expect embellished jackets, artisanal embroidery, flowing drapes, and architectural cuts, all signature to the designers' unapologetically opulent aesthetic. With the film slated for release on 20 June 2025, the fashion buzz surrounding Sitaare Zameen Par is giving it a head start long before audiences hit the theatres. This red-carpet reveal also marks an exciting synergy between cinema and couture, where costumes aren't just worn, they're performed. Directed by R. S. Prasanna of Shubh Mangal Saavdhan fame, Sitaare Zameen Par brings together Aamir Khan, Genelia Deshmukh, and an ensemble of newcomers. Add to that the musical brilliance of Shankar-Ehsaan-Loy, lyrics by Amitabh Bhattacharya, and a screenplay by Divy Nidhi Sharma, and the film is poised to make waves across entertainment and fashion, headlines. Sonam Kapoor owns royal throne in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la golden tissue saree

From her high-end couture style to her lavish saree sways, Sonam Kapoor reigns supreme in fashion. Taking to Instagram, the style mogul posted a carousel of her latest saree look that is both a scroll-stopper and a show-stopper. Sonam curated the saree from the celebrated Indian design label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la, and dripped with traditional royalty. Let's dive into her look! Styled by Sonam's all-time stylist and sister, Rhea Kapoor, and Abhilasha Devnani, the Khoobsurat actress draped the saree in a free-hand pallu style. She slung the pallu around her bodice, with its one part tucked neatly on the left shoulder and the other one tossed around her right shoulder, cascading forward and resting on her bosom. The vivid intersection of the gilded borders formed a stunning neckline, serving 'Maharani' vibes. Besides, the U-shape cascade at the back revealed her awe-striking backless blouse. Adding to the regality of her Abu Jani Sandeep Khosla sway, the Zoya Factor actress donned distinguished, eccentric jewelry. She flaunted a kundan-studded jalidar choker with its trim tucked with strings of pearls. Kapoor complemented this delicate choker with a quaint, golden neckpiece, an absolute work of art. The chunky necklace featured an array of gold motifs, with slight gaps in between, reminiscent of fish scales. It was too, tucked with a string of pearls on the outer edge, while subtly revealing the inner surface of the intricate neckpiece. Sonam Kapoor added kundan-studded golden tops, matching her necklaces. She also slipped on two large kundan-tucked, golden chunky bangles, one on each hand, completing her regal finesse. For her make-up, the Neerja actress flaunted a minimal, rosy, and dewy glam. She sported a glowy base with blushed-up cheeks and a light contour. The actress kept her eyemakeup subtle with barely-there eyeshadows, light mascara, and shimmery, nude-pink lips. She adorned her forehead with a tiny bindi. Lastly, the Sanju fame boasted a sleek updo, with a center-partition, and her hair neatly tucked into a bun, adorned with a gajra.
